    ‘Charge according to your worth’ – Shallipopi tells artistes

    By September 6, 2024 News No Comments1 Min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    Singer Shallipopi has advised his fellow artistes to charge according to their values.

    He stated this while addressing the debate over high fees charged by Nigerian artistes.

    Speaking in an interview with News Central TV, the singer noted that an artiste’s value is linked to the success and reach of their music.

    While disputing the notion that Nigerian artists have overpriced themselves out of the local market, he emphasised that artistes who achieve similar streaming as American artistes should charge comparable fees.




    “It depends on your music and where it has gotten, that is what your price is going to be.

    “If your music has gotten the same stream as an American artiste, you should be charging the same way they charge but if is not up to that you cannot overcharge,” he stated.
